IT@程序员猿媛猿客栈互联网科技

SQL中的用户权限管理

2019-07-18  本文已影响2人  Kkite
-- 1.创建一个新用户 用户名:abc  密码:abc 使用范围:本机
CREATE USER 'abc'@'localhost' IDENTIFIED BY 'abc';

-- 2.删除用户
DROP USER 'abc'@'localhost';

-- 3.查询权限
SHOW GRANTS;

-- 4.修改密码 为123
SET PASSWORD = PASSWORD('123');

-- 5.授权 ALL为所有权限 *.*表示所有数据
GRANT ALL ON *.* TO 'abc'@'localhost';

-- 6.开发一个贴吧程序准备数据库
CREATE DATABASE tieba DEFAULT CHARACTER SET UTF8;

-- 7.删除用户
DROP USER 'tieba'@'localhost';

-- 8.为贴吧创建一个账户
CREATE USER 'tieba'@'localhost' IDENTIFIED BY '123';

-- 9.为tieba账号授权
GRANT ALL ON tieba.* TO 'tieba'@'localhost';

-- 10.回收tieba账号的CREATE,DROP权限
REVOKE CREATE, DROP ON tieba.* FROM 'tieba'@'localhost';

如有错误或建议欢迎大家指出与评论哈,希望这篇博文能帮助到大家,大家也可以分享给需要的人。

如需转载,请注明出处。https://www.jianshu.com/p/7662e5868bdb

上一篇 下一篇

猜你喜欢

热点阅读